American Black Walnut

Appearance: Heartwood ranges from a deep, rich dark brown to a purplish black. Sapwood is nearly white to tan. Difference between heartwood and sapwood color is great.
Grain: Mostly straight and open, but some boards have burled or curly grain.
Hardness: Janka: 1010; (22% softer than Northern red oak).
Finish: Takes most finish well. Staining is not typical.
